> You seem just the guy I'd like to get some information from. I'm
> looking at buying a Touch/external hard drive/active speakers to use as
> my main music system. The Touch will be in a bedroom approx 13' x 16',
> so I could use the onscreen functions and remote, but I wanted to be
> able to control it via wireless netbook. From what I'm understanding,
> to do that I'd install the Squeezebox Server to the netbook which is
> cool, but can I still use the onscreen touch functions if I wish? I
> wouldn't want to lose that as I take the netbook out with me, and then
> my partner wouldn't be able to use the Touch. Is that right?
> 
> Also, I take it the Touch will connect to Active Monitors no problem?
> 
> Cheers John, hope you can help.

There is no computer UI control of the Touch when using Touch's inbuilt
server + USB source material.
Touch's touch screens and IR remote are fully functional regardless of
what Touch is connected to (TinySBS on Touch, full SBS on computer,
MySB.com online).

If you had Touch connected to full SBS on a computer (giving you UI
control), simply switch Touch to it's own internal server from the
Touch itself.

Active monitors (or any self powered, self amplified speakers) will
work great with Touch.   :)
